Web15 mrt. 2024 · The tank size depends on how many Neon’s you are going to keep. If you plan on keeping about 6, then a 10-gallon could work. However, if you’re keeping 10-15 Neon Tetras, you would need at least a 15-gallon tank. It’s not just the size of the fish that you need to think about when selecting the ideal tank. Neon tetras like to swim in schools. The bare minimum school size would be 5-6 but a school that small would still run the risk of feeling threatened and could get stressed and aggressive with each other.
